Nevada Revised Statutes Section 625A.120 - Professions, Occupations and Businesses

Examination: Written or oral; place and time; identification by number; records; reexamination.

1. Except for an applicant applying pursuant to subsection 2 or 3 of NRS 625A.110, an applicant who is otherwise eligible for registration, has paid the fee and presented the required credentials must appear personally and pass the written examination certified by the National Environmental Health Association or an equivalent examination prepared by the Board.

2. If the application is filed pursuant to subsection 2 of NRS 625A.110, the Board may use the written examination certified by the National Environmental Health Association or a written or oral examination prepared by the Board.

3. The examination must be administered by the Board not less than once each year at such time and place in this state as the Board specifies.

4. The name of the applicant must not appear on the examination, and the applicant must be identified by a number assigned to him by the Secretary of the Board.

5. All examinations and the records pertaining to them must be filed with the Secretary of the Board and retained for at least 5 years.

6. If an applicant fails the examination, he may be reexamined upon resubmission of his application accompanied by the required fee.
